Re: pneumatic tubing swelling

Quote:
Originally Posted by Jon Stratis View Post
...It also comes with a steel mesh leader hose - this is considered part of the compressor (per last year's Q &A, at least... I haven't seen it asked this year yet), and can be used to help ensure the tubing is well away from the hot parts of the compressor!
Al chimed in with his opinion earlier this year (I know, that doesn't make it official )

Quote:
Originally Posted by Al Skierkiewicz View Post
As a caveat, the Viair above comes with a stainless steel hose that is required for operation by the manufacturer. The hose helps dissipate the heat generated by the compressor and compressed air.
but, at last check, hasn't been posted to the Q&A yet.

(We've used it in the past, but don't expect to this year - our pneumatic load isn't that high.)
